Foundation Repair Services

Foundation repair involves assessing and fixing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ically include identifying the root causes of foundation problems, such as settling, cracking, or shifting, and implementing solutions to stabilize and restore the integrity of the foundation. Common methods used by professionals may involve under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ization techniques designed to address specific types of foundation issues. The goal is to prevent further damage, improve safety, and help maintain the property's value over time.

Many foundation problems are caused by so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ction, which can lead to c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er function properly. Foundation repair services help resolve these issues by providing structural reinforcement and addressing underlying causes. This can include installing support piers beneath the foundation to lift and stabilize the structure or sealing cracks to prevent water intrusion. Proper repair work can mitigate the risk of more severe damage and costly repairs in the future.

Properties that typically require foundation repair services include residential homes, especially those with basements or crawl spaces, as well as commercial buildings and multi-unit dwellings. Older properties are often more susceptible to foundation issues due to age and soil conditions, but newer structures can also experience problems if construction was not properly executed or if environmental factors cause soil movement. Regardless of property type, addressing foundation concerns early can help preserve the building’s safety and stability.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Scott County, MN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. Minor repairs might cost around $2,000, while extensive foundation stabilization can exceed $10,000 in some cases.

Crack Repair Expenses - Repairing foundation cracks generally falls within the $500 to $2,500 range. Small cracks may cost less than $1,000, whereas larger or more complex crack repairs tend to be more costly.

Pier and Beam Foundation Costs - Services for pier and beam foundation stabilization typically cost between $3,000 and $10,000. The price varies based on the number of piers needed and the severity of the foundation issues.

Cost Factors - Overall foundation repair costs can vary due to factors such as soil conditions, foundation size, and accessibility.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ific property conditions in Scott County, MN, and surrounding are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ators may include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, or gaps around window frames.

How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but local contractors can provide estimates based on specific assessments.

Are foundation repairs disruptive to my home? Repair processes can cause some disruption, but experienced service providers aim to minimize inconvenience during the work.

What causes foundation issues in homes? Common causes include soil settlement, poor drainage, moisture fluctuations, or tree roots exerting pressure on the foundation.

How can I prevent future foundation problems?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els around the property, and addressing minor issues early can help prevent future damage. Contact local pros for tailored recommendations.
